Show The task of looking after the uniforms aud other costumes of tho Emperor William Wil-liam is by no means a sinecure. All theso different and greatly varying articles ar-ticles of attire, as diversified as those at tho disposal of a star actor, aro carefully careful-ly kept, systematically arranged and in large wardrobes, and at tho head of the department is an official entitled the oborgardorobier, who has under his command com-mand two valets do ohambra Tho nautical nau-tical uniforms aro placed under the charge of au ex-subofficer of the German Ger-man navy. Before the omperOr undertakes under-takes any one of his many expeditions tho obergarderobier is provided with an exhaustive list of all tho dresses and other paraphernalia that will be re-Quired. re-Quired.
